EAST LANSING, Mich. (WILX) - Microplastics in our environment can be a big issue for health, leading to Alzheimer’s and even heart attacks.

These develop because of hard-to-recycle plastics, like multilayer plastics, that are found in grocery stores and hospitals.

A team of Michigan State University researchers developed a new type of plastic that can be recycled and could replace this hard-to-recycle type.

Multilayer plastics are commonly found covering food and medical products.

Even though they are very thin, they have 12 layers of different types of polymers in them. Since these polymers are all different, they cannot be recycled together.

To recycle this plastic, each layer would have to be separated, which can become tedious.
